Ordinals
beta
Sat 809785782140609
decimal
161957.782140609
degree
0°161957′677″782140609‴
percentile
38.56122776339875%
name
icpizxpauzo
cycle
0
epoch
0
period
80
block
161957
offset
782140609
timestamp
2012-01-13 05:21:42 UTC
rarity
common
prev
next